Sandy Ayala
I LOVE this place. Since this location is right across the street from my job, I have lunch here at least 3 times a week and the food is amazing every time. I normally get the choose two option. On a normal day I get a sandwich and soup, but when I am very hungry I get a salad and a sandwich, and still hardly ever finish everything. The salad is very filling. The staff is very friendly. I order online because their line can get very long during my lunch time at noon. I have never had any issues with my food not being ready when I order online. Everything I order is always freshly made by the time I pick up. You get to customize your meal, when you order online, and if you are a picky eater like myself, then this comes in very handy. I think the price is actually pretty reasonable, considering the portion sizes, especially if you select the try two option. If I see a new soup on their online menu for the day, then I wait in line and try it. You get to try as many soups as you like. Highly recommend this place.
